Indian women's recurve team qualify for Rio Olympics

Deepika Kumari was impressive in the first round match against Germany

The Indian women’s recurve team comprising of Deepika Kumari, Rimil Buriuly and Laxmirani Majhi booked their places in the Rio Olympics with a 5-3 win over Germany.

The second set turned it around for the Indians where they posted two scores of perfect 10. The Germans hung in there, but six scores of 8 and no 10 in the third and fourth sets cost them a place in the last eight.

India will take on Columbia in the quarterfinal.
